  • Tonight's best wine, no questions asked. Wow! What a classical showing!

    Upon plop: thin bagatelle.
    After four hrs of dbl decanting, this showed beautifully at Le Message.

    Robe: semi rich mature Bdx colour.
    Nez: deep, rich, earthy old European, beautiful thing with a small herd of cattle grazing nearby. Lovely! Amazing!
    Gouche: a beautiful Rioja tempranillo showing off restraint in all aspects. Small bite in the tannins, fantastic acidic lift, hint of dill on top of the beautiful rich, loamy aroma of earth… No hinta of oxidisation as of yet. Not much in the department of berries and fruits, but a lot more to be found in the herbs and spice dept. Wow! A full bodied old-style old-world wine that has everything you could ever ask for. Mjuff!

    The first btl to run its course tonight.

    Even if some Fruitf**kers say it's near the end of its strech, I would like to calm down all of you who are stashed: our btl had the poorest cork and took ages to extract. However! With that, this showing at this age and grape, this magnificent wine isn't going anywhere soon. Early drinking window as long as you thoroughly decant it first.

RJonWine.com

  • By Richard Jennings
    5/2/2011, (See more on RJonWine.com...) 90 points

    (Faustino Rioja I Gran Reserva) Aromatic, charcoal, dried berry nose; tight, tart berry, dried berry palate; needs 2 years; medium-plus finish 90+ points (90% Tempranillo, 6% Graciano, 4% Mazuelo)
